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/ajv-validator/ajv

The fastest JSON schema Validator. Supports JSON Schema draft-04/06/07/2019-09/2020-12 and JSON Type Definition (RFC8927)
https://github.com/ajv-validator/ajv

Merge pull request #1425 from teq0/issue-1421

Issue 1421 - allow colons in keyword names

33722772d89b428ff167730cd7955adff3cc8a0d authored almost 4 years ago by Evgeny Poberezkin <[email protected]>
Issue 1421 - allow colons in keyword names

3727ae6fd768c495092fb41598b6da73eedc858e authored almost 4 years ago by teq0 <[email protected]>
jtd: run tests (skipped)

ad0cf01482ee2424a806ec503dc4c8bc49007f03 authored almost 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.4

63486ce5aa1f9b942775098ae7228cb2408d245f authored almost 4 years ago by Evgeny Poberezkin <[email protected]>
fix: reference resolution issue with base URI change, fixes #1414

c91e8ba055eb7d79297f676d22957a9121a39726 authored almost 4 years ago by Evgeny Poberezkin <[email protected]>
Fix for issue #1361 - duplicate functions in standalone code with mutually recursive schemas (#1418)

* test: skipped failing test showing duplicate functions in standalone code for mutually recursi...

0b7567bea4de45aaadcb0530ab04521097ef81f5 authored almost 4 years ago by Evgeny Poberezkin <[email protected]>
improvement: reset properties context if a schema of type object is iterated

90f7293062f5808080d48214a08619231fb04442 authored almost 4 years ago by anxietypb <[email protected]>
improvement: look up parent object properties in checkRequired

157d8ae591046b4b8201024c67f5b8e6b148b338 authored almost 4 years ago by anxietypb <[email protected]>
docs: include basic strictRequired description

d219cf53a8bdcf43902dcbe5fc45606dc88913df authored almost 4 years ago by anxietypb <[email protected]>
test: add first unit tests for strictRequired

b49183efa3b36253f3180039a4335b6b4655d0fb authored almost 4 years ago by anxietypb <[email protected]>
feat: checkRequired schema validation

2b23c47f91508c058bf6c0932e3a702e9158a5a2 authored almost 4 years ago by PBug90 <[email protected]>
7.0.3

ca2ae61c489f45fa2ec3ff2ee78b10136cb1ed3c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ge branch 'hello-weiran-issue1364'

78cc974351034e1b39e7864fcf0f844f0e3cb309 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: move "using in ES5 env" to readme

c44597e3e19f711c1892eea04807ca0c67b11d95 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ge branch 'issue1364' of https://github.com/hello-weiran/ajv into hello-weiran-issue1364

d0b1368559d634339c6f1fe87be471c322b84f74 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: add option to the example using json-schema-secure schema (#1373)

9200e928c8927bf6c626d5f9488b6e9ca7e6171d authored about 4 years ago by Evgeny Poberezkin <[email protected]>
remove duplicate import (rollup/plugins#745)

4de9bfb53397d2d2c3d8e3fc38b6237dcac40c2b auth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1370 from caub/patch-1

fix range example typos

97bfa50862cfcaf8fe998507c45dcb8bf4adcb88 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ix range example typos

71ef1e09d3d5065d1da2e03a06f1bc18dff6f652 authored about 4 years ago by Cyril Auburtin <[email protected]>
Merge pull request #1368 from G-Rath/patch-2

fix: add `| null` to `OneOfError` param property

342b84dbe6b4d02eceea22592294238ff1e56fe9 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ix: add `| null` to `OneOfError` param property

9121a870ebfa3bb6b1d072cc91b4cd2c22b817ef authored about 4 years ago by Gareth Jones <[email protected]>
docs: add pre-es6 usage (fixes #1364)

286ca0f08b7c14f2e01d5f5e6199f323f0503238 authored about 4 years ago by weiran <[email protected]>
test: standalone code with ajv-formats (#1363)

d153e812494a527658000347edcd22967e83766b auth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.2

5c28d853673948c86ab3d876a31c14dae9d63d32 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1362 from ajv-validator/fix-standalone

Fix for standalone code generation creating duplicate functions

832fee18d39dd1e7c3db4766c029474b81530db9 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ix: standalone code generation creating duplicate functions (closes #1361)

0b89a00fc36d9e618c79b464bf4efff08cc26eb9 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: failing test for standalone code (duplicate functions, #1361)

eae2d5d47426e8b4c355e6613fcf2c3f5e61eec2 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: duplicate function in standalone code, it should fail but it does not (#1361)

e446893f5bc1711fa782839eb760ca2c04c1cbfe authored about 4 years ago by Evgeny Poberezkin <[email protected]>
ci: only update website on push to master (not on PR), closes #1358

5fe4bc04dda46ff289b58b6192cfecc0fece728c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1355 from orgads/readme-links

README: Fix broken links

bd9578377bc22f327a491a2df0833f0f15d8118a authored about 4 years ago by Evgeny Poberezkin <[email protected]>
README: Fix broken links

53022710b1b8d121600e40da1f491b50e94a9d43 authored about 4 years ago by Orgad Shaneh <[email protected]>
7.0.1

616a725993d6d271ada3845f8b050ac226f3a217 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1353 from nicksrandall/patch-1

Add user-friendly message for maxLength validation

dc55ff2a7e138ff69b84e2c52f1bffdcee984075 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Add user-friendly message for maxLength validation

"should not have fewer than 5 items" feels weird for a string of characters. I think we should r...

b68927a5338c39f4c6a91e69cfe7f812ea149e00 authored about 4 years ago by Nick Randall <[email protected]>
7.0.0

cd7c6a8385464f818814ebb1e84cc703dc7ef02c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: update to release v7

0809171ee4735a3a0c10d3d5202ea01b9d13601b auth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update build workflow

f1f4b7407c1c93cb763904b744f0ab8c4f769523 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update website script

e9962b5b55a6f738c6c772ec24f41d81e0f4c386 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update CONTRIBUTING

cd81777ba43854b5ae7892539669508d4427902a authored about 4 years ago by Evgeny Poberezkin <[email protected]>
website workflow

736e680fe03934574cf9acf3c4c9e618056bf673 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.5

12690aca66cbca594a16d85f2a0ce961f9b1877c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update publish-bundles script

108dbe6883cbb97dad12bde160d5659aae7f8484 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.4

82d052175ceef1e4b5c1890f60fc4c4b5f6e5ef2 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ix publish bundle script

544eb9d5da12374713f22808d7b68ceea177716a auth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.3

680532989543b60b449658aec35b33f7c07ca937 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1351 from ajv-validator/ajv-dist

Publish bundles to ajv-dist

6388f6dd3111a58d99d2f192b549f3f3b8aab3e6 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
publish bundles to ajv-dist

fceb5cc6c1eee93540181d4007282f1238b577fa authored about 4 years ago by Evgeny Poberezkin <[email protected]>
publish bundles

e6b3b8aba743f06c3e540f4f4d92abf5147a5afc authored about 4 years ago by Evgeny Poberezkin <[email protected]>
publish bundle to ajv-dist (testing)

701089d89e9719ada3d603e74bdd998596954362 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
ci: env variables for git user

1106cfa7a723dfc738dfbc4bc38e5763cccb5263 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.2

3545374786e1c121b0f4aa65f1c2bedfde9cfa04 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
ci: publish bundles

6c6c6efb920d885cabba76ce81b37ee71a6beb9d authored about 4 years ago by Evgeny Poberezkin <[email protected]>
ci: publish main version to npm

5c662b3f129d3498d47107654c56fcb148bc95fe auth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1349 from ajv-validator/browser-tests

Browser bundles and tests

8d6b35b77d434451ca4df2bf2e86cd691a959adf auth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: more browser friendly tests, rename draft-07 browser bundle and globals in both browser bundles

2bcaadd27569bb8f5b2b4c5ce9ce316b51e49bc6 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1340 from ajv-validator/dependabot/npm_and_yarn/eslint-config-prettier-7.0.0

build(deps-dev): bump eslint-config-prettier from 6.15.0 to 7.0.0

ce5eb3847fd02755eb40e26d5881646e7672045b authored about 4 years ago by Evgeny Poberezkin <[email protected]>
build(deps-dev): bump eslint-config-prettier from 6.15.0 to 7.0.0

Bumps [eslint-config-prettier](https://github.com/prettier/eslint-config-prettier) from 6.15.0 t...

6639c3028ab90c66db9f0e941a2f6634b9ebaa9b authored about 4 years ago by dependabot-preview[bot] <27856297+dependabot-preview[bot]@users.noreply.github.com>
upgrade: [email protected]

5c45d2efdbe186d0f774a5b6f9f69a254d0f4f78 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
upgrade: [email protected]

06344cfb2c323e1c63917a1e975d503f52a32b18 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
dynamic/recursiveRef: support dynamic/recursiveAnchor not in root, check that anchor is present (no support yet for $id changing resolution scope, similar to #815)

25508f470f945512e037eaddc1120c390f51c17c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update JSON-Schema-Test-Suite

bd8d86579386cb58854e9db74a5dc7b2d1894806 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: add code components, closes #1347

f0e4920889f87ccd362069ff8b657108b4069552 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: additional tests for standalone validation code, closes #1348

35da896e8b7999ae4359aa514ffea0a6b7e0ee18 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: rename withPack to withStandalone

88b07defbab4acb2692de25049e0d80e14a5f1ae auth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1345 from ajv-validator/fhir-standalone

Non-root recursive ref with standalone code (FHIR schema, issue #1344)

fabf1ba553d42355f4480ee486a26bb2d2323d75 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ix: non-root recursive ref with standalone code (e.g. FHIR schema), closes #1344

882ae52db77faa317cbaa3ae5ccd391c83324e15 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
reduced failing schema for #1344

26db61421ab247d0c4cd4216a84f5172e3c48ec0 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
failing test for #1344 (compiling fhir schema to standalone code)

62066560b8a4b4e5ec9877748b2cef084641a4e3 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.1

2721434704ca17edcfa801cad43dc2b79d894f13 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
add data reference to schema type in keyword specific error object types

9f1c3eaa4b91ca17b72b122cdac9b108d1ac30cb auth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ix dependencies schema type

4cab7817f11ce31dcfacdbc69b833627884e12d4 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
upgrade @ajv-validator/config (removes esModuleInterop)

ba752505cf53a136eda1c4f4b81bf9e697a42dc2 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
type of schema in error object dependent on keyword

8421cce07ec8c8f4888dfce3de96e3e917928cb8 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-rc.0

cf39c22267ce6eaea47640efbf4a6a997e0862cf auth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ix eslint warnings

8e2248ce1ddffd14fe317cef5ded8b54ac943add authored about 4 years ago by Evgeny Poberezkin <[email protected]>
do not use const/var in "for" loops in es5 mode

b8230628da0647febaa2c578049c580662590ad6 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
use code options es5, line in standalone code generation

a07334cbe922997452c39f7fcb4b9d00cb1ab014 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-beta.9

7b4402e285cc572447013942f58f677b8252a0d7 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
types: JSONSchemaType support for draft-2019-09 keywords, update types

e816cd24b60068b3937dc7143beeab3fe6612391 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
fix publish workflow

2c25b22620a1527b1557f2edaee9b7a226a9877a authored about 4 years ago by Evgeny Poberezkin <[email protected]>
update publish workflow

080f794af914e69bc75281ea88b4d3e2dad270b1 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
7.0.0-beta.8

723512c9c0c6a79c5b7cee2c3f24f94b61707150 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
github workflow to publish to npm

45fd2fc3105b0f12f0ad9fbe52ed79bbf770cc9d auth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: update build badge to github

cd685ca0f5a69e9e21a9e28959717566aa3b9075 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
test: update github workflow

2bf5263a8bb2f0dc7328a6d299bf6e3d9b4cd79e auth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1332 from ajv-validator/pack

Generation of standalone validation code

d8d5d850b7fd485165735224d1ddd61d5dddd4f2 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Send coverage to coveralls (#1335)

* Update test.yml

* test: add coveralls

7c022be85b468fc0d0bdbd2a3035d98cb0f236eb auth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Merge pull request #1334 from ajv-validator/github-actions

Create test.yml

7b280b73ed3c83c350ee443f23769839d78c38bd authored about 4 years ago by Evgeny Poberezkin <[email protected]>
Create test.yml

e6e846c6e0322ed01d1f4d0430aa708424dcb158 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
docs: update references to standalone code generation

f0861197c3ba5468631a9247e31b3533e1910f2c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
support macro keywords with standalone code; move setting option code.formats from tests to ajv-formats; docs: standalone code generation

10828e50fbb2649df37906e8feffdf638de4e42a authored about 4 years ago by Evgeny Poberezkin <[email protected]>
refactor: combine functions to generate standalone code for named and all exports

c4251d324d1a381eb2a408d5b739d39ec36f5555 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
generate standalone code for all schemas in Ajv instance (excluding meta), refactor

36683f932b7ed03fb0b015e9bf5816af00da1946 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
refactor: use validate method from Ajv core in AjvPack

2145d3eec3c6492ed73e017e28be7b89e8d24db0 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
generate standalone module with multiple exported validation functions

fa2a3a93a4c14c795501092bdb67283b9491f34c authored about 4 years ago by Evgeny Poberezkin <[email protected]>
rename folder "pack" to "standalone"

2044f084b6332d063801488e674c0a3612bdc223 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
use npm link in CI

a84e5612da522ff267ce4b494e39639625016d90 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
additional tests, fix CI

72e8d54429b0ed5a219199c3679ddb173256b382 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
standalone code for a single function (test-suite passes)

82c8d41b0ea8ab13cdecab4fbc8181d06c0e70c8 authored about 4 years ago by Evgeny Poberezkin <[email protected]>
support ref to root schema in standalone code (35 tests fail)

187c9aad362ed80dc07a0c766cc456505d374a21 authored about 4 years ago by Evgeny Poberezkin <[email protected]>